Beat Poet - Distil
Entitled 'Distil' the purpose of Beat Poet's AW 11/12 collection is to distill a modern man's wardrobe to its essence; a challenge they thankfully approach in a non 'Perfume' like fashion. Cues are taken from military uniforms which they use as a measure of masculinity. Youthful nonchalance is melded with sophisticated, directional tailoring.
The fundamentals of any menswear closet - the parka jacket, the duffel coat, the Bronx leather jacket, the classic coat and suits are taken back to the drawing board as Beat Poet strip them to their essentials before reconfiguring them, maintaining their heritage yet offering a new perspective. A blazer is set to leather while one side of an embellished motorcycle jacket is added, acting as an extension of the casual single breasted blazer. Collars such as the albany are experimented with as the neckline gains a focus.
Though what I adore most about this collection is its acute attention to detail. Military badges are reinterpreted and placed upon ties. Boots are given stirrups. As every detail is 'distilled'.
